What is the Detox Process?

Usually, a Residential Detox in Heron Bay, Alabama lasts is up to a week, the amount of time depends on the amount used, type of drug, and other factors. Once you find a rehab facility in Heron Bay, Alabama you are on your way to sobriety, the detox process allows you to be in an illicit-drug free setting place of serenity and peace of mind. Further residential treatment is often necessary for an addict to fully pursue long term freedom, addiction treatment detoxes can give individuals who have struggled with substance abuse hope and abstinence. When undergoing drug and alcohol detox, many individuals are tapered down via prescription drugs, tapering is employed to help manage the pain, psychological issues, and physical concerns associated with the detox process. Medical staff administer the taper drugs. After completing the detox process in Heron Bay, Alabama, patients are transferred to long-term treatment centers that often offer more challenges- Further treatment often entails a long-term rehab setting that puts patients at a decreased risk of relapse.

WHY IS DETOX IMPORTANT?

Detoxing by yourself can be very dangerous depending on which drugs you’re withdrawing from. Especially in the case of alcohol or benzodiazepine withdrawal, an individual will need medical support. Doctors are able to monitor your physical help and get you immediate medical help incase of an emergency. Detox from opiates or stimulants like cocaine or methamphetamine may not be fatal, but it allows you to recover in a comfortable setting at a Detox Center.
